    this is what I do regarding targetting relevant ads

    put keyword on article tittle
    put keyword on URL (auto if using wp blog)
    put/spread keyword on the content
    make sure the post/page has at least few incoming links, from other sites or from your other pages
    this is important to push the bot crawls your page
    if you're using wordpress you can use related post and random post plugin

    actually it's just like basic seo. you have to push the bot to crawl your page (with links) and make sure it knows what your articles is about.
